A way to uninstall Alternate Directory 3.900 from your computer

You can find on this page detailed information on how to remove Alternate Directory 3.900 for Windows. It is produced by Alternate Tools. You can find out more on Alternate Tools or check for application updates here. Click on to get more data about Alternate Directory 3.900 on Alternate Tools's website. The application is often installed in the C:\Program Files (x86)\Alternate\Directory directory. Take into account that this path can differ depending on the user's decision. The entire uninstall command line for Alternate Directory 3.900 is C:\Program Files (x86)\Alternate\Directory\unins000.exe. The program's main executable file is titled Directory.exe and its approximative size is 771.50 KB (790016 bytes).

The executable files below are part of Alternate Directory 3.900. They take an average of 1.68 MB (1761290 bytes) on disk.

  • Directory.exe (771.50 KB)
  • unins000.exe (700.51 KB)
  • UnInstCleanup.exe (248.00 KB)


This page is about Alternate Directory 3.900 version 3.900 alone.
